Agent Patterns
Sprint coordinates multiple specialized agents through structured communication patterns. This skill covers the SPAWN REQUEST format, report structure, parallel execution, and inter-agent coordination.

Key rule: Only the orchestrator spawns agents. Agents communicate by returning structured messages.
SPAWN REQUEST Format
The architect requests agent spawning using a specific format:
## SPAWN REQUEST - python-dev - nextjs-dev - cicd-agent
Parsing Rules
The orchestrator parses SPAWN REQUEST blocks:
- •Section must start with
## SPAWN REQUESTon its own line - •Each agent listed as a bullet point
- •Multiple agents spawn in parallel
Implementation Agents
Request during Phase 2:
## SPAWN REQUEST - python-dev - nextjs-dev
Never include test agents in implementation requests.
Testing Agents
Request during Phase 3:
## SPAWN REQUEST - qa-test-agent - ui-test-agent
The ui-test-agent runs in AUTOMATED or MANUAL mode based on specs.md:
- •
UI Testing Mode: automated(default) → runs test scenarios automatically - •
UI Testing Mode: manual→ opens browser for user to test, waits for tab close
Agent Report Format
All agents return structured reports. The orchestrator saves these as files.
Standard Report Sections
Every report includes:
| Section | Purpose |
|---|---|
| CONFORMITY STATUS | YES/NO - did agent follow specs? |
| SUMMARY | Brief outcome description |
| DEVIATIONS | Justified departures from specs |
| FILES CHANGED | List of modified files |
| ISSUES | Problems encountered |
| NOTES FOR ARCHITECT | Suggestions, observations |

Parallel Execution
Implementation Agents
Spawn all implementation agents simultaneously:
Task: python-dev ─────────▶ Backend Report Task: nextjs-dev ─────────▶ Frontend Report Task: cicd-agent ─────────▶ CICD Report
Use a single message with multiple Task tool calls.
Testing Agents
QA runs first, then UI tests:
Task: qa-test-agent ─────────▶ QA Report
│
▼
Task: ui-test-agent ─────────▶ UI Test Report
Task: diagnostics ─────────▶ Diagnostics Report
(parallel with ui-test)
UI test and diagnostics agents run in parallel with each other.
Agent Constraints
What Agents Can Do
- •Read specification files
- •Read project-map.md (read-only)
- •Implement code in their domain
- •Run tests in their domain
- •Return structured reports
What Agents Cannot Do
- •Spawn other agents
- •Modify
status.md(architect only) - •Modify
project-map.md(architect only) - •Create methodology documentation
- •Push to git repositories
File-Based Coordination
When agents need to coordinate beyond reports:
Report Files
Orchestrator saves reports as:
.claude/sprint/[N]/[slug]-report-[iteration].md
Slugs:
- •
python-dev→backend - •
nextjs-dev→frontend - •
qa-test-agent→qa - •
ui-test-agent→ui-test
Specialized Agent Roles
Project Architect
The decision-maker:
- •Creates specification files
- •Maintains project-map.md and status.md
- •Analyzes agent reports
- •Decides next steps (implement, test, finalize)
Implementation Agents
Technology-specific builders:
- •
python-dev: Python/FastAPI backend - •
nextjs-dev: Next.js frontend - •
cicd-agent: CI/CD pipelines - •
allpurpose-agent: Any other technology
Testing Agents
Quality validators:
- •
qa-test-agent: API and unit tests - •
ui-test-agent: Browser-based E2E tests - •Framework-specific diagnostics agents
FINALIZE Signal
The architect signals sprint completion:
FINALIZE Phase 5 complete. Sprint [N] is finalized.
The orchestrator detects this and exits the iteration loop.
